Ford NU (AU) Fairlane front bumper fog lights experiment (Intro)

Image
 Introduction: I have this bit of a front bumper left over from a recent NU Fairlane bumper repair job.   After seeing how every newer car has the foggies on each edge of the lower scoop section of their front bumper I have decided to have a crack at doing the same on this very ugly looking bumper, hopefully the foggies might give it some more appeal.                             Here is a stock photo of the front of this beast without any foggies:-  So using a discarded section of the right hand scoop edge I will try to weld in some fog light inserts cut out of a Toyato Carmy bumper, and use some aftermarket LED fog light sets suitable for most Toyato's.  After measuring the Carmy bumper fog insert section It should fit in pretty well into the lower scoop section.
